ADM Thomas Fargo on American Foreign Policy in Asia Pacific (thinktech 338 hdv 0924)
The 40th Annual Paul Chung Memorial Lecture presented by the Pacific Asia Management Institute of the Shidler College of Business, featuring a talk by ADM Thomas Fargo, USN (Ret), on American Foreign Policy in Asia Pacific, particularly regarding North Korea.
